I've noticed that when installing packages that contain type hints, those hints don't get installed.

For example take https://github.com/hynek/svcs

If I install the dev dependencies using uv pip install --reinstall --editable .[dev] I get Mypy and FastAPI installed.

But, if I run mypy tests/typing/fastapi.py, I get:

tests/typing/fastapi.py:12: error: Skipping analyzing "fastapi": module is installed, but missing library stubs or py.typed marker  [import-untyped]
tests/typing/fastapi.py:13: error: Skipping analyzing "fastapi.responses": module is installed, but missing library stubs or py.typed marker  [import-untyped]
tests/typing/fastapi.py:13: note: See https://mypy.readthedocs.io/en/stable/running_mypy.html#missing-imports
tests/typing/fastapi.py:60: error: Untyped decorator makes function "view" untyped  [misc]
tests/typing/fastapi.py:69: error: Untyped decorator makes function "view2" untyped  [misc]
Found 4 errors in 1 file (checked 1 source file)

Running pip install --force-reinstall fastapi fixes it:

Success: no issues found in 1 source file

Between the installations, I can observe how $VIRTUAL_ENV/lib/python3.12/site-packages/fastapi/py.typed is missing and appears after installing it using pip. If I reinstall using uv, it vanishes again.

charliermarsh commented Feb 17, 2024

I haven't figured out why yet, but something in the requirements is leading us to choose a really old version of FastAPI. Like, it looks like we first try to pin starlette, but we start with a version that's too new for FastAPI, so then we try all the FastAPI versions, and maybe we eventually find a FastAPI version that doesn't require starlette at all.

Yeah, unfortunately uv is producing a valid resolution (I assume), it's just not identical to pip's because the resolver ends up taking a different path. (There are many valid resolutions, even under the constraint that you want to choose the latest available versions.) If we iterated over the packages in a different order, we might end up with the same thing. But I agree that the outcome here seems bad, and we should try to hint at the resolver to take a different path.

@mpizenberg
Copy link

So this is a case where the resolution path produces a very undesirable solution, but another path produces a much more desirable one. Interesting. The main issue is probably that pubgrub doesn't explore the whole solution space and stops as soon as one solution is found. And as soon as one package is pinned it won't ever change the chosen version except if it reaches a dead-end and backtracks.

In a way, we can say that the pyproject is not correctly specified, because it says it's compatible with any fastapi version, which is not true. It's only that the current solver in pip chooses something that fits the bill. In my opinion the correct answer is to fix the dependency specification inside svcs.

I see fastapi has an upper bound on starlette: https://github.com/tiangolo/fastapi/blob/master/pyproject.toml#L44

I will again suggest that it might be better when you have two requirements and one of the packages upper bounds the other requirements that you prefer backtracking on the package that is upper bounded: #1398 (comment)

With the caveat that this is my intuition on what would produce better results and I've not had a chance to try and implement it myself yet and prove it.

The main issue is probably that pubgrub doesn't explore the whole solution space and stops as soon as one solution is found

FYI, it's easy to produce a set of requirments where the whole solution space is larger than the number of atoms in the obserable universe. All real world dependency resolution algorithms will stop pretty quickly once they have a solution.

All real world dependency resolution algorithms will stop pretty quickly once they have a solution.

Indeed, what I meant to say is that some solvers have a notion of "good" solution, like SMT solvers (such as microsoft Z3). But pubgrub does not. It only has local decision making strategies. So like "what should we try NOW"? but no notion of optimality of a solution.
